GRILLED NAPA CABBAGE FATTOUSH SALAD RECIPE BY TASTY

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 20

1 head medium napa cabbage
1 small red onion, thinly sliced
3 vine ripe tomatoes, diced into large cubes
1 persian cucumber, sliced
3 pita breads, cut into wedges
4 oz cow's milk feta, crumbled
6 Radishes, sliced
2 teaspoons za'atar
1 tablespoon sumac spice
¼ cup fresh mint, chopped
¼ cup fresh parsley, chopped
⅛ cup dill, chopped
2 lemons
2 oz red wine vinegar
2 tablespoons whole grain mustard
1 teaspoon pink salt
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
3 oz extra virgin olive oil
1 teaspoon sumac spice
2 teaspoons za'atar

Steps:

  • Preheat the grill and preheat the oven to 375°F.
  • Cut cabbage in half lengthwise, brush lightly with olive oil, and proceed to grill until deeply charred. Immediately place in the fridge to avoid cooking the cabbage any further.
  • Cut pita bread into small wedges and toss with 2 tbsp olive oil and salt. Place on a cookie sheet pan and place in the oven for about 7-10 minutes, or until crisp and toasted. Cool on a rack on the counter.
  • Prepare salad ingredients and place all in a large bowl, including the grilled cabbage and toasted pita wedges.
  • Place all dressing ingredients in a glass jar and shake vigorously prior to dressing the salad.
  • Add the amount of desired dressing to the salad and toss.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ed.
  • Serve.

NAPA CABBAGE SALAD

This is a yummy, crunchy cabbage salad with toasted ramen noodles and almond slivers. The bowl is always licked clean at potlucks!

Time 30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 head napa cabbage
1 bunch minced green onions
⅓ cup butter
1 (3 ounce) package ramen noodles, broken
2 tablespoons sesame seeds
1 cup slivered almonds
¼ cup cider vinegar
¾ cup vegetable oil
½ cup white sugar
2 tablespoons soy sauce

Steps:

  • Finely shred the head of cabbage; do not chop. Combine the green onions and cabbage in a large bowl, cover and refrigerate until ready to serve.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Make the crunchies: Melt the butter in a pot. Mix the ramen noodles, sesame seeds and almonds into the pot with the melted butter. Spoon the mixture onto a baking sheet and bake the crunchies in the preheated 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) oven, turning often to make sure they do not burn. When they are browned remove them from the oven.
  • Make the dressing: In a small saucepan, heat vinegar, oil, sugar, and soy sauce. Bring the mixture to a boil, let boil for 1 minute. Remove the pan from heat and let cool.
  • Combine dressing, crunchies, and cabbage immediately before serving. Serve right away or the crunchies will get soggy.
